Checking my Lotto at a retail store is not accurate. 2 days ago I checked my Lotto tickets at P nP . I had 3 . With one I won R11:00 with the other R4:00 and R0: respectively . I asked for 2 more tickets . The young man serving me got my request wrong and he needed help to correct it . Now they were speaking in their home language and I had no idea what they were saying but from the sequence of events it must of gone along the lines of him telling her , a much older Pnp employee working at the same counter, that I had given him 3 tickets to check, 2 of them had won some money, the third had not. I had asked for 2 new tickets andhe got it all wrong and did not know how to correct the mistake . She did and she showed him how - In the process she showed me that all 3 tickets had won something , not only 2 and my total winnings wew R25:00 not R15:00. The same had happened to me 2 or 3 years earlier where I was told a ticket that had actually won R800:00 had won R0:00. The store's manager sorted that out for me . My point. I read that Lotto was holding millions in " unclaimed winnings. " I am now asking, are those unclaimed winnings or claimed but not paid out winning" similar to what happened to me. Whose responsibility is it to ensure winners get their R5 & R10 winnings
